CIMR-V7GR42P2 | Yaskawa | Inverter Drive 400V 3 Phase 2.2kWFull-range Automatic Torque Boost (when V/f Mode is Selected: n002=0) The motor torque requirement changes according to load conditions. The full-range automatic torque boost adjusts the voltage of the V/f pattern according to requirements. The V7AZ automatically adjusts the voltage during constant-speed operation, as well as during acceleration. The required torque is calculated by the Inverter. This ensures tripless operation and energy-saving effects. Normally, no adjustment is necessary for the Torque Compensation Gain (n103, factory setting: 1.0). When the wiring distance between the Inverter and the motor is long, or when the motor generates vibration, change the automatic torque boost gain. In these cases, set the V/f pattern (n011 to n017). Adjustment of the Torque Compensation Time Constant (n104) and the Torque Compensation Iron Loss (n105) are normally not required. Adjust the torque compensation time constant under the following conditions: • Increase the setting if the motor generates vibration. • Reduce the setting if response is slow
